Right when I began Regretting Gabriel, knew from the
very start that this was going to be an emotional read that would bring tears
to my eyes, and it did more than once. This is so much more than a Rockstar romance,
it is about healing, forgiveness, love and finding that someone who makes you
want to be better.
Both Gabriel and Cady have events in their past that have
molded them into the people that they have become, these events were life
changing, heart breaking and in a sense self-molding. The connection between
Gabriel and Cady is intense, the chemistry is unbelievably hot, but it is the
connection of their hearts that is the most beautiful of all.
Regretting Gabriel kept me captivated from the beginning
until the end, if I had one small complaint, it would be that I wish we had
more at the end, I just wanted more, and for me the need for more is what makes
a book great. Add this to your TBR list I think you will love it.

Author Bio
The first time Anna tried to read a
romance novel, her hair caught on fire when she leaned over a candle to sneak a
peek at her mom’s Harlequin. She thinks being hit on the head with a shirtless
Fabio until the smoke cleared is what sparked the flame for her love of
romance.
Anna was born in Wisconsin, but currently lives in Texas with her husband and two boys. She writes sexy romance that always has a happy ending and loves bringing characters back for cameos. Less than six degrees of separation connects any of her novels.
When she’s not writing or reading, she’s watching reruns of her favorite romcoms, talking to her dog and cat like they’re human, eating carbs, or practicing hand lettering.
